在数据可视化领域,ECharts 是一款非常流行的 JavaScript 库,它可以帮助开发者轻松创建交互式图表。其中,Y 轴次方展示技巧是 ECharts 中一个非常有用的功能,可以让我们在处理非线性数据时,更好地展示数据的趋势和变化。下面,我将详细介绍如何使用 ECharts 的 Y 轴次方展示技巧,实现数据可视化效果。
1. ECharts 简介
ECharts 是一个使用 JavaScript 实现的开源可视化库,它提供了一整套完整的图表类型,包括折线图、柱状图、饼图、散点图等。ECharts 的特点如下:
- 丰富的图表类型:支持多种图表类型,满足不同场景的需求。
- 高度可配置:几乎所有的图表属性都可以进行自定义配置。
- 跨平台:支持 PC、移动端等多种平台。
- 丰富的文档和示例:提供了详细的文档和丰富的示例,方便开发者学习和使用。
2. Y 轴次方展示技巧
在 ECharts 中,我们可以通过设置 Y 轴的 type 属性为 'log' 来启用对数轴,从而实现 Y 轴次方展示效果。
2.1 基本配置
以下是一个简单的 ECharts 实例,展示了如何使用 Y 轴次方展示技巧:
//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: 'Y轴次方展示示例'
},
tooltip: {},
legend: {
data:['销量']
},
xAxis: {
data: ["衬衫","羊毛衫","雪纺衫","裤子","高跟鞋","袜子"]
},
yAxis: {
type: 'log' // 开启对数轴
},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
2.2 数据处理
在使用 Y 轴次方展示技巧时,我们需要注意以下几点:
- 数据范围:对数轴的数据范围必须是正数,且不能包含 0。
- 数据精度:对数轴的数据精度较低,可能会对图表的展示效果产生影响。
- 数据转换:如果原始数据不满足对数轴的要求,我们需要先进行数据转换。
3. 实际应用
Y 轴次方展示技巧在以下场景中非常有用:
- 展示非线性数据:例如,展示人口增长率、经济增长率等。
- 比较不同数量级的数据:例如,展示不同年份的 GDP、人口数量等。
- 突出数据变化趋势:例如,展示产品销量、股票价格等。
通过掌握 ECharts 的 Y 轴次方展示技巧,我们可以更好地展示数据,使图表更具说服力和可读性。希望本文能帮助您在数据可视化领域取得更好的成果。
